Hamas Leader Isma'il Haniya: No Contradiction between Hamas Participating in the Resistance and in Legislative Council

Following are excerpts from an address given by Hamas leader Isma'il Haniya, which aired on Al-Jazeera TV on January 26, 2006.

Isma'il Haniya: What is historically known as the Sykes-Picot agreement divided the Arab and Islamic world into states and countries. The truth is that we deal with this agreement as if it were a fait accompli, yet we do not recognize it. We do not recognize the fragmentation of the Arab and Islamic world.

This stems from the reality of the Palestinian land. There is an occupation oppressing the Palestinian people. There is a reality that was imposed upon the Palestinian people. We deal with this reality, but we do not recognize it. We deal with this reality, but we do not recognize it as legitimate.

[...]

Resistance is a principle and a legitimate right of the Palestinian people, which we will not give up.

Hamas has entered the Legislative Council only to defend the resistance and its fighters, until all the Palestinian rights are restored. There is no contradiction whatsoever between Hamas participation in the resistance, and its presence in the Legislative Council - no contradiction whatsoever.
